Stunning Stay 2 Serra da Arrabida Panorama Comfort
A short journey from Montijo brings you to the Serra da Arrabida region where dramatic limestone cliffs and blue coves unfold along the coast. The coastal trails here are among the most scenic in Portugal and you can choose routes suitable for families with well graded paths and plenty of shade. A favourite option is a gentle hike to a lookout that offers open views across the sea to the far horizon. Pack a light lunch and a blanket for a waterfront picnic at one of the protected coves where the water is clear and calm enough for easy snorkelling in summer months. Portinho da Arrabida is a close by gem where the mountains meet the sea, and the town of Sesimbra nearby serves up fresh seafood in a casual harbour setting. If you are visiting during a calm morning, consider a small boat tour along the shoreline that reveals hidden caves and sea caves bathed in brilliant light. For travellers who want a restful day with a touch of adventure, this stay anchors you near the Arrabida Natural Park with views that are consistently memorable. Stunning Stay 5 Sesimbra Village and Castle Viewpoints
Sesimbra is a charming fishing town famous for its castle perched above the bay. A morning wander through the harbour reveals boats bobbing at the quay while the scent of grilled sardines drifts from sea facing eateries. The old town lanes lead you to the castle where you can wander the stone walls and enjoy panoramic views over the town below and the endless sea beyond. A short stroll to the nearby rocky coves offers opportunities for safe family swims and gentle cliffside paths that are well signposted. The town also runs a lively fish market in the morning where you can observe locals trade the fresh catch of the day. For the more adventurous, a coastal trail takes you to secluded beaches and rock pools that reveal small shoreside ecosystems during the right tide. Sesimbra is a classic day trip from Montijo and a reminder that some of the best views come from close to the waterline. Stunning Stay 8 Sado Estuary Dolphin Watching and River Walks
The Sado Estuary is famous for its resident bottlenose dolphins that sometimes surface in the early morning calm. A boat trip from Setubal or nearby towns offers a chance to spot these intelligent creatures while learning about the estuary and its ecosystem from knowledgeable guides. The trips are designed with safety in mind and the crews follow strict guidelines to protect both wildlife and guests. After the boat ride you can stretch your legs along riverside paths that offer gentle walks through reed beds and shaded spots perfect for a family friendly afternoon. Birdwatching opportunities abound with white storks and herons standing still at the water’s edge. If you prefer a land based option, there are quiet trails along the water that are ideal for a relaxed stroll with kids. Stunning Stay 10 Mercado do Livramento and Coastal Seafood Trail
Setubal’s Mercado do Livramento is famed for its colour and bustle, and it is a feast for the senses. A morning wander through the stalls reveals the freshest seafood, vibrant produce and local delicacies that become the heart of a delicious day. After you stock up on the morning harvest you can join a guided coastal food walk that introduces you to a handful of family run eateries along the waterfront. The seafood trails highlight seasonal catches prepared in simple, honest ways that reflect the area’s culinary roots. A short walk from the market takes you to the harbour where boats bring in another daily supply of fresh fish and you can watch the activity at the marina. If you are visiting with kids, there are friendly spots near the market where you can pause for an ice cream and a quick game while you plan the rest of your day.
